About me

I am a seasoned clinician with over 25 years of experience in behavioral health, specializing in trauma treatment and systems-level care. Trained in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) and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R). When someone enters treatment, they will be greeted by someone who brings a depth of clinical insight to the therapeutic setting. I provide a safe, confidential, and non-judgmental space that allows clients to vent, process, and manage the challenges that brought them into treatment. Throughout my careeer, I have worked with individuals and organizations navigating high-stress environments. My career in the fire department has shaped a focused expertise in trauma management, crisis response, and post-incident recovery. As founder of Signal-5 Consulting, John integrates clinical best practices with operational strategy—supporting CARF accreditation, Medicaid compliance, and scalable documentation systems that reflect both therapeutic integrity and regulatory rigor

The clients I'm best positioned to serve

I am best positioned to serve individuals who have experienced high-intensity or cumulative trauma, especially first responders, veterans, and those in caregiving or crisis-facing roles. Many of my clients come to therapy feeling emotionally exhausted, hypervigilant, or disconnected from themselves and others. They are often high-functioning but privately overwhelmed, seeking a safe, confidential space where they can safely process what they have carried for years. With advanced training in CBT and EMDR, I help clients build insight, restore nervous system balance, and reclaim a sense of agency. My approach is practical, compassionate, and grounded in the realities of trauma exposure.
